Monroe County FHA Mortgage Overview

For Monroe County homebuyers using an FHA loan, the 11.54% down payment on a $210,800 property provides accessible entry, but requires mandatory Mortgage Insurance Premiums (MIP) for the loan’s life due to the 88.46% loan-to-value ratio. This structure is ideal for those with a sub-620 credit score seeking an FHA loan down payment analysis in Monroe County, West Virginia. The effective property tax rate of 0.53%, with a 0.8% inflation-adjusted increase, adds modest monthly cost. When evaluating an FHA mortgage with property taxes, MIP and taxes must be factored into true affordability, especially since all loans here are for primary residences.
